Show-Markdown
Toont een Markdown-bestand of -tekenreeks in de console op een beschrijvende manier met behulp van VT100 escape-reeksen of in een browser met HTML.
Syntaxis
Show-Markdown
[-Path] <String[]>
[-UseBrowser]
[<CommonParameters>]
Show-Markdown
-InputObject <PSObject>
[-UseBrowser]
[<CommonParameters>]
Show-Markdown
-LiteralPath <String[]>
[-UseBrowser]
[<CommonParameters>]
Description
De Show-Markdown
cmdlet wordt gebruikt om Markdown weer te geven in een door mensen leesbare indeling in een terminal of in een browser.
Show-Markdown
kan een tekenreeks retourneren die de VT100-escapereeksen bevat die door de terminal worden weergegeven (als deze VT100-escapereeksen ondersteunt). Dit wordt voornamelijk gebruikt voor het weergeven van Markdown-bestanden in een terminal. U kunt deze tekenreeks ook ophalen via de ConvertFrom-Markdown
door de parameter AsVT100EncodedString op te geven.
Show-Markdown
heeft ook de mogelijkheid om een browser te openen en u een gerenderde versie van de Markdown weer te geven. De Markdown wordt weergegeven door deze om te zetten in HTML en het HTML-bestand te openen in uw standaardbrowser.
U kunt wijzigen hoe Show-Markdown
Markdown in een terminal wordt weergegeven met behulp van Set-MarkdownOption
.
Deze cmdlet is geïntroduceerd in PowerShell 6.1.
Voorbeelden
Voorbeeld 1: Eenvoudig voorbeeld waarin een pad wordt opgegeven
Show-Markdown -Path ./README.md
Voorbeeld 2: Eenvoudig voorbeeld waarin een tekenreeks wordt opgegeven
@"
# Show-Markdown
## Markdown
You can now interact with Markdown via PowerShell!
*stars*
__underlines__
"@ | Show-Markdown
Voorbeeld 2: Markdown openen in een browser
Show-Markdown -Path ./README.md -UseBrowser
Parameters
-InputObject
Een Markdown-tekenreeks die wordt weergegeven in de terminal. Als u geen ondersteunde indeling doorgeeft, Show-Markdown
wordt er een fout verzonden.
Type: | PSObject |
Position: | Named |
Default value: | None |
Vereist: | True |
Pijplijninvoer accepteren: | True |
Jokertekens accepteren: | False |
-LiteralPath
Hiermee geeft u het pad naar een Markdown-bestand. In tegenstelling tot de parameter Path wordt de waarde van LiteralPath exact gebruikt zoals deze is getypt. Er worden geen tekens geïnterpreteerd als jokertekens. Als het pad escapetekens bevat, plaatst u het tussen enkele aanhalingstekens. Enkele aanhalingstekens geven PowerShell aan dat er geen tekens als escapereeksen moeten worden geïnterpreteerd.
Type: | String[] |
Aliassen: | PSPath, LP |
Position: | Named |
Default value: | None |
Vereist: | True |
Pijplijninvoer accepteren: | True |
Jokertekens accepteren: | False |
-Path
Hiermee geeft u het pad naar een Markdown-bestand dat moet worden weergegeven.
Type: | String[] |
Position: | 0 |
Default value: | None |
Vereist: | True |
Pijplijninvoer accepteren: | True |
Jokertekens accepteren: | True |
-UseBrowser
Compileert de Markdown-invoer als HTML en opent deze in uw standaardbrowser.
Type: | SwitchParameter |
Position: | Named |
Default value: | False |
Vereist: | False |
Pijplijninvoer accepteren: | False |
Jokertekens accepteren: | False |
Invoerwaarden
String[]